前11月广州对共建“一带一路”国家进出口同比增长24%
Nan Fang Ri Bao Wang Luo Ban· 2025-12-23 07:46
Core Viewpoint - Guangzhou's foreign trade import and export value exceeded 1.1 trillion yuan in the first 11 months of this year, showing a year-on-year growth of 12.1% [1] Group 1: Trade Performance - The import and export value with countries involved in the Belt and Road Initiative reached 531.24 billion yuan, marking a year-on-year increase of 24% [1] - The trade cooperation with Belt and Road countries has shown a sustained positive trend, becoming an important trade partner for Guangzhou [1] Group 2: Support Measures - Guangzhou Customs has arranged dedicated personnel to follow up on enterprise needs, understanding production processes and export plans to facilitate smooth exports of "new three samples" products [1] - Special actions to promote cross-border trade facilitation have been actively carried out, with new support measures introduced to stabilize and enhance foreign trade quality [1] Group 3: Logistics and Infrastructure - The integration of logistics in the Guangdong-Hong Kong-Macao Greater Bay Area has been deepened, improving the connectivity of coastal ports like Nansha Port and the Pearl River inland terminals [1] - A single declaration process allows goods to be quickly transferred from Huadu Port to Nansha Port and then to international shipping vessels [1]
非媒:中国科技助力非洲转型发展
Huan Qiu Wang Zi Xun· 2025-12-22 22:39
Core Insights - Emerging technologies such as IoT, big data analytics, and artificial intelligence are rapidly developing and have the potential to transform global society and economy. Africa has a unique opportunity to leverage these technologies and reliable partnerships for socio-economic transformation, potentially contributing approximately $1.5 trillion to its GDP by 2030 through accelerated sustainable growth and development [1][2]. Group 1: Technological Development and Economic Impact - The advancements in renewable energy, broadband infrastructure, and digital public services are enhancing resilience and promoting inclusive technology applications to aid development [1]. - The African Union's Agenda 2063 and the African Continental Free Trade Area (AfCFTA) provide critical frameworks that can benefit from the increasing prevalence of emerging technologies and favorable tech partnerships [1][2]. - The African Digital Transformation Strategy (2020-2030) prioritizes broadband expansion, digital skills training, e-governance, data governance, and support for emerging technologies like AI and fintech, guiding Africa's related efforts [1][2]. Group 2: China-Africa Technological Partnership - China's growing partnership with Africa in the tech sector involves governments and major telecom and mobile companies, indicating that reliable partnerships can effectively bridge the digital divide and promote inclusive economic participation and growth [2]. - China is a significant force in promoting development in the Global South through various initiatives, including the Belt and Road Initiative and the China-Africa Cooperation Forum, focusing on common development, security, cultural exchange, and equitable global governance [2][3]. - Chinese government and enterprises are crucial partners in Africa's tech-driven modernization, providing ICT support that aids economic growth and public service delivery in sectors like e-governance, healthcare, and education [2][3]. Group 3: Infrastructure and Capacity Building - Chinese enterprises have piloted AI systems in urban management, fintech solutions, and hydropower operations in several African countries, with ongoing efforts to apply technology in green energy and food security [3]. - The China-Africa Technology Partnership Program 2.0 includes joint projects for building R&D centers, tech parks, and sustainable development initiatives, marking a deepening of long-term mutually beneficial development positioning [3][4]. - China has made significant investments in Africa's digital infrastructure, assisting in the construction of extensive backbone networks totaling approximately 150,000 kilometers, with over 200,000 kilometers of fiber optic laid [3][4]. Group 4: Education and Long-term Development - China supports African universities and vocational education, launching specialized technical talent training programs and establishing joint R&D innovation institutions to deepen tech cooperation [4]. - The China-Africa partnership has acted as a catalyst in bridging Africa's digital divide, with future prospects for solidifying tech cooperation as a primary frontier for sustainable socio-economic transformation and modernization [4].
